android - 如何使用工具 :overrideLibrary ="io.flutter.plugins.camera"

标签 android flutter android-camera

我正在尝试在 flutter 中使用相机插件(对于来自相机的 Image Picker 作为源),我知道我需要一个最小 sdk 版本到 21 才能使用它,但是当我看到错误时它也提示我们还可以覆盖插件使用(这可能会导致运行时崩溃)

 use tools:overrideLibrary="io.flutter.plugins.camera" to force usage (may lead to runtime failures)

enter image description here 所以任何人都可以指出我如何覆盖它的正确方向吗?

最佳答案

使用

在 AndroidManifest.xml 中

如果您使用稳定版,也请尝试将 Flutter SDK 版本更改为 DEV。

同时检查:

https://github.com/flutter/plugins/pull/1598/files

关于android - 如何使用工具 :overrideLibrary ="io.flutter.plugins.camera",我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/59531202/

相关文章:

java - 在 RecyclerView 中显示多个 Room 数据库表中的数据

android - 是否可以在 Flutter 中创建自定义快速设置磁贴?

flutter - 因为 sdk 中的 flutter_driver 的每个版本都依赖于 crypto 2.1.5 而 Cruise 依赖于 crypto 3.0.0,所以 sdk 中的 flutter_driver 是被禁止的

flutter - SliverAppBar 滚动时 flexibleSpace 内的图标不隐藏

java - 如何镜像显示OpenCV JavaCameraView前置摄像头(Android)?

Android:如何在不运行持续服务来检查时间的情况下检测用户是否更改系统时间

android - 如何检查 SharedPreferences 文件是否存在

android - 拍的照片比预览大

android - Android 中的 "public float getFocalLength ()"和 "public void getFocusDistances (float[] output)"有什么区别?

Android Gradle 构建错误 :Ticks in transparent frame must be black or red